I would wait until the end of the season before I get too excited about these wins. Nice to have them yes but nobody has received a Pool A because of them. The MWC is improving and figures to have 3 or 4 "NCAA worthy" teams but getting 2 in will always be a tall task as the bottom half drags their alphabet soup selection criteria ratings down.

When you look at the years the MWC has had 2 in it was because those 2 dominated the conference. *1989. However it's not as easy to dominate the conference as it used to be.

I don't think there has ever been a question of the top of the MWC being able to compete with other leagues.  Even if the wins don't match the losses vs. the WIAC, there have always been some tough games.  LU and Carroll have shown they are tourney teams in the past.  I said two years ago when they got Grzesh (sp?) from Lakeland that St. Norb's would be a player sooner than later.  They've beaten Platteville and Oshkosh. 

On the other hand, Roop is right.  In a 5 game series, I still truly believe Point and Platteville would beat Carroll and St. Norb's.  But, they are big steps and it gives the MWC some national exposure.  They are also big wins come tourney time because of the "point system" the NCAA uses.

Congrats to LU, Carroll and St. Norb's for toppling the WIAC's best, but it's not even January yet!
